Helen P. (Jurkiewicz) Lemek at 96 died peacefully surrounded by her loving family on April 17, 2023. Daughter of Michael and Stefania (Kozdronkiewicz) Jurkiewicz she was a lifelong resident of Ludlow. She served as Town Clerk for 24 years and belonged to many civic organizations. A faithful communicant of Christ the King Church, she was a member of many Sodalities and helped with food sales, picnics and organizing trips to shrines in Canada. She was instrumental in establishing their Perpetual Adoration Chapel and served as head coordinator. Her day began at the chapel and then morning mass, she loved her church, community and family. Christmas and Easter were especially enjoyed making and serving traditional Polish food to family and friends entertaining, gardening and watching the Red Sox were her favorite pastimes. She will be deeply missed by her daughter Elizabeth Babinski and son Christopher and his wife Debbie Lemek. She was a cherished Babci to 10 grandchildren and 15 great grandchildren as well as many nieces, nephews and extended family and friends. Sadly, she was predeceased by her husband Stanley, son Michael (Cathy), grandson Aaron Babinski, son-in-law Thomas Babinski and sister Irene Michonski.
